Skip to content

Commit b7aaa8d

Browse files
committed
Update zynq cores to 2019.1 and add ultrascale+ compatibility
Signed-off-by: Michael Brown <producer@holotronic.dk>
1 parent f9a4df7 commit b7aaa8d

File tree

11 files changed

+106
-121
lines changed

11 files changed

+106
-121
lines changed

HW/VivadoProjects/microzed/microzed_jd2cb/ip/hm2_ip_wrap_jd2/component.xml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1534,9 +1534,6 @@
15341534
<xilinx:canUpgradeFrom>user.org:user:HostMot2_ip_wrap_jd2:1.0</xilinx:canUpgradeFrom>
15351535
</xilinx:upgrades>
15361536
<xilinx:coreCreationDateTime>2016-07-12T12:57:00Z</xilinx:coreCreationDateTime>
1537-
<xilinx:tags>
1538-
<xilinx:tag xilinx:name="machinekit.io:user:HostMot2_ip_wrap_jd2:1.0_ARCHIVE_LOCATION">/home/developer/mksocfpga/HW/VivadoProjects/microzed/microzed_jd2cb/ip/hm2_ip_wrap_jd2</xilinx:tag>
1539-
</xilinx:tags>
15401537
</xilinx:coreExtensions>
15411538
<xilinx:packagingInfo>
15421539
<xilinx:xilinxVersion>2015.4</xilinx:xilinxVersion>

HW/VivadoProjects/microzed/microzed_jd2cb/ip/jd2_mad_logic/component.xml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-165,9 +165,6 @@
165165
<xilinx:canUpgradeFrom/>
166166
</xilinx:upgrades>
167167
<xilinx:coreCreationDateTime>2016-08-16T21:11:06Z</xilinx:coreCreationDateTime>
168-
<xilinx:tags>
169-
<xilinx:tag xilinx:name="jd2.com:user:jd2_mad_logic:1_ARCHIVE_LOCATION">/home/developer/mksocfpga/HW/VivadoProjects/microzed/microzed_jd2cb/ip/jd2_mad_logic</xilinx:tag>
170-
</xilinx:tags>
171168
</xilinx:coreExtensions>
172169
<xilinx:packagingInfo>
173170
<xilinx:xilinxVersion>2015.4</xilinx:xilinxVersion>

HW/VivadoProjects/zturn/zturn_jd2cb/ip/jd2_mad_logic/component.xml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-165,9 +165,6 @@
165165
<xilinx:canUpgradeFrom/>
166166
</xilinx:upgrades>
167167
<xilinx:coreCreationDateTime>2016-08-15T03:32:48Z</xilinx:coreCreationDateTime>
168-
<xilinx:tags>
169-
<xilinx:tag xilinx:name="jd2.com:user:jd2_mad_logic:1_ARCHIVE_LOCATION">/home/developer/mksocfpga/HW/VivadoProjects/zturn/zturn_jd2cb/ip/jd2_mad_logic</xilinx:tag>
170-
</xilinx:tags>
171168
</xilinx:coreExtensions>
172169
<xilinx:packagingInfo>
173170
<xilinx:xilinxVersion>2015.4</xilinx:xilinxVersion>

HW/zynq-ip/btint_axi_1.0/component.xml

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-831,11 +831,6 @@
831831
<xilinx:vendorURL>http://www.jd2.com</xilinx:vendorURL>
832832
<xilinx:coreRevision>4</xilinx:coreRevision>
833833
<xilinx:coreCreationDateTime>2016-07-06T20:58:46Z</xilinx:coreCreationDateTime>
834-
<xilinx:tags>
835-
<xilinx:tag xilinx:name="user.org:user:btint:1.0_ARCHIVE_LOCATION">/home/developer/btint_ip/btint_1.0</xilinx:tag>
836-
<xilinx:tag xilinx:name="jd2.com:user:btint:1.0_ARCHIVE_LOCATION">/home/developer/btint_ip/btint_1.0</xilinx:tag>
837-
<xilinx:tag xilinx:name="jd2.com:user:btint_axi:1.0_ARCHIVE_LOCATION">/home/developer/mksocfpga/HW/zynq-ip/btint_axi_1.0</xilinx:tag>
838-
</xilinx:tags>
839834
</xilinx:coreExtensions>
840835
<xilinx:packagingInfo>
841836
<xilinx:xilinxVersion>2015.4</xilinx:xilinxVersion>

HW/zynq-ip/hm2_axilite/component.xml

Lines changed: 39 additions & 35 deletions
Original file line numberDiff line numberDiff line change
@@ -242,7 +242,7 @@
242242
<spirit:parameters>
243243
<spirit:parameter>
244244
<spirit:name>viewChecksum</spirit:name>
245-
<spirit:value>d835fd14</spirit:value>
245+
<spirit:value>5cfbc0dd</spirit:value>
246246
</spirit:parameter>
247247
</spirit:parameters>
248248
</spirit:view>
@@ -258,7 +258,7 @@
258258
<spirit:parameters>
259259
<spirit:parameter>
260260
<spirit:name>viewChecksum</spirit:name>
261-
<spirit:value>d835fd14</spirit:value>
261+
<spirit:value>5cfbc0dd</spirit:value>
262262
</spirit:parameter>
263263
</spirit:parameters>
264264
</spirit:view>
@@ -371,7 +371,7 @@
371371
</spirit:wire>
372372
</spirit:port>
373373
<spirit:port>
374-
<spirit:name>S_AXI_ACLK</spirit:name>
374+
<spirit:name>S_AXI_aclk</spirit:name>
375375
<spirit:wire>
376376
<spirit:direction>in</spirit:direction>
377377
<spirit:wireTypeDefs>
@@ -384,7 +384,7 @@
384384
</spirit:wire>
385385
</spirit:port>
386386
<spirit:port>
387-
<spirit:name>S_AXI_ARESETN</spirit:name>
387+
<spirit:name>S_AXI_aresetn</spirit:name>
388388
<spirit:wire>
389389
<spirit:direction>in</spirit:direction>
390390
<spirit:wireTypeDefs>
@@ -397,7 +397,7 @@
397397
</spirit:wire>
398398
</spirit:port>
399399
<spirit:port>
400-
<spirit:name>S_AXI_AWADDR</spirit:name>
400+
<spirit:name>S_AXI_awaddr</spirit:name>
401401
<spirit:wire>
402402
<spirit:direction>in</spirit:direction>
403403
<spirit:vector>
@@ -417,7 +417,7 @@
417417
</spirit:wire>
418418
</spirit:port>
419419
<spirit:port>
420-
<spirit:name>S_AXI_AWPROT</spirit:name>
420+
<spirit:name>S_AXI_awprot</spirit:name>
421421
<spirit:wire>
422422
<spirit:direction>in</spirit:direction>
423423
<spirit:vector>
@@ -437,7 +437,7 @@
437437
</spirit:wire>
438438
</spirit:port>
439439
<spirit:port>
440-
<spirit:name>S_AXI_AWVALID</spirit:name>
440+
<spirit:name>S_AXI_awvalid</spirit:name>
441441
<spirit:wire>
442442
<spirit:direction>in</spirit:direction>
443443
<spirit:wireTypeDefs>
@@ -453,7 +453,7 @@
453453
</spirit:wire>
454454
</spirit:port>
455455
<spirit:port>
456-
<spirit:name>S_AXI_AWREADY</spirit:name>
456+
<spirit:name>S_AXI_awready</spirit:name>
457457
<spirit:wire>
458458
<spirit:direction>out</spirit:direction>
459459
<spirit:wireTypeDefs>
@@ -466,7 +466,7 @@
466466
</spirit:wire>
467467
</spirit:port>
468468
<spirit:port>
469-
<spirit:name>S_AXI_WDATA</spirit:name>
469+
<spirit:name>S_AXI_wdata</spirit:name>
470470
<spirit:wire>
471471
<spirit:direction>in</spirit:direction>
472472
<spirit:vector>
@@ -486,7 +486,7 @@
486486
</spirit:wire>
487487
</spirit:port>
488488
<spirit:port>
489-
<spirit:name>S_AXI_WSTRB</spirit:name>
489+
<spirit:name>S_AXI_wstrb</spirit:name>
490490
<spirit:wire>
491491
<spirit:direction>in</spirit:direction>
492492
<spirit:vector>
@@ -503,7 +503,7 @@
503503
</spirit:wire>
504504
</spirit:port>
505505
<spirit:port>
506-
<spirit:name>S_AXI_WVALID</spirit:name>
506+
<spirit:name>S_AXI_wvalid</spirit:name>
507507
<spirit:wire>
508508
<spirit:direction>in</spirit:direction>
509509
<spirit:wireTypeDefs>
@@ -519,7 +519,7 @@
519519
</spirit:wire>
520520
</spirit:port>
521521
<spirit:port>
522-
<spirit:name>S_AXI_WREADY</spirit:name>
522+
<spirit:name>S_AXI_wready</spirit:name>
523523
<spirit:wire>
524524
<spirit:direction>out</spirit:direction>
525525
<spirit:wireTypeDefs>
@@ -532,7 +532,7 @@
532532
</spirit:wire>
533533
</spirit:port>
534534
<spirit:port>
535-
<spirit:name>S_AXI_BRESP</spirit:name>
535+
<spirit:name>S_AXI_bresp</spirit:name>
536536
<spirit:wire>
537537
<spirit:direction>out</spirit:direction>
538538
<spirit:vector>
@@ -549,7 +549,7 @@
549549
</spirit:wire>
550550
</spirit:port>
551551
<spirit:port>
552-
<spirit:name>S_AXI_BVALID</spirit:name>
552+
<spirit:name>S_AXI_bvalid</spirit:name>
553553
<spirit:wire>
554554
<spirit:direction>out</spirit:direction>
555555
<spirit:wireTypeDefs>
@@ -562,7 +562,7 @@
562562
</spirit:wire>
563563
</spirit:port>
564564
<spirit:port>
565-
<spirit:name>S_AXI_BREADY</spirit:name>
565+
<spirit:name>S_AXI_bready</spirit:name>
566566
<spirit:wire>
567567
<spirit:direction>in</spirit:direction>
568568
<spirit:wireTypeDefs>
@@ -578,7 +578,7 @@
578578
</spirit:wire>
579579
</spirit:port>
580580
<spirit:port>
581-
<spirit:name>S_AXI_ARADDR</spirit:name>
581+
<spirit:name>S_AXI_araddr</spirit:name>
582582
<spirit:wire>
583583
<spirit:direction>in</spirit:direction>
584584
<spirit:vector>
@@ -598,7 +598,7 @@
598598
</spirit:wire>
599599
</spirit:port>
600600
<spirit:port>
601-
<spirit:name>S_AXI_ARPROT</spirit:name>
601+
<spirit:name>S_AXI_arprot</spirit:name>
602602
<spirit:wire>
603603
<spirit:direction>in</spirit:direction>
604604
<spirit:vector>
@@ -618,7 +618,7 @@
618618
</spirit:wire>
619619
</spirit:port>
620620
<spirit:port>
621-
<spirit:name>S_AXI_ARVALID</spirit:name>
621+
<spirit:name>S_AXI_arvalid</spirit:name>
622622
<spirit:wire>
623623
<spirit:direction>in</spirit:direction>
624624
<spirit:wireTypeDefs>
@@ -634,7 +634,7 @@
634634
</spirit:wire>
635635
</spirit:port>
636636
<spirit:port>
637-
<spirit:name>S_AXI_ARREADY</spirit:name>
637+
<spirit:name>S_AXI_arready</spirit:name>
638638
<spirit:wire>
639639
<spirit:direction>out</spirit:direction>
640640
<spirit:wireTypeDefs>
@@ -647,7 +647,7 @@
647647
</spirit:wire>
648648
</spirit:port>
649649
<spirit:port>
650-
<spirit:name>S_AXI_RDATA</spirit:name>
650+
<spirit:name>S_AXI_rdata</spirit:name>
651651
<spirit:wire>
652652
<spirit:direction>out</spirit:direction>
653653
<spirit:vector>
@@ -664,7 +664,7 @@
664664
</spirit:wire>
665665
</spirit:port>
666666
<spirit:port>
667-
<spirit:name>S_AXI_RRESP</spirit:name>
667+
<spirit:name>S_AXI_rresp</spirit:name>
668668
<spirit:wire>
669669
<spirit:direction>out</spirit:direction>
670670
<spirit:vector>
@@ -681,7 +681,7 @@
681681
</spirit:wire>
682682
</spirit:port>
683683
<spirit:port>
684-
<spirit:name>S_AXI_RVALID</spirit:name>
684+
<spirit:name>S_AXI_rvalid</spirit:name>
685685
<spirit:wire>
686686
<spirit:direction>out</spirit:direction>
687687
<spirit:wireTypeDefs>
@@ -694,7 +694,7 @@
694694
</spirit:wire>
695695
</spirit:port>
696696
<spirit:port>
697-
<spirit:name>S_AXI_RREADY</spirit:name>
697+
<spirit:name>S_AXI_rready</spirit:name>
698698
<spirit:wire>
699699
<spirit:direction>in</spirit:direction>
700700
<spirit:wireTypeDefs>
@@ -736,7 +736,8 @@
736736
<spirit:file>
737737
<spirit:name>src/hm2_axilite_int.vhd</spirit:name>
738738
<spirit:fileType>vhdlSource</spirit:fileType>
739-
<spirit:userFileType>CHECKSUM_d835fd14</spirit:userFileType>
739+
<spirit:userFileType>CHECKSUM_5cfbc0dd</spirit:userFileType>
740+
<spirit:userFileType>USED_IN_ipstatic</spirit:userFileType>
740741
</spirit:file>
741742
</spirit:fileSet>
742743
<spirit:fileSet>
@@ -753,11 +754,15 @@
753754
<spirit:name>src/hm2_axilite_gen32_simreg.vhd</spirit:name>
754755
<spirit:fileType>vhdlSource</spirit:fileType>
755756
<spirit:userFileType>IMPORTED_FILE</spirit:userFileType>
757+
<spirit:userFileType>USED_IN_simulation</spirit:userFileType>
758+
<spirit:userFileType>USED_IN_testbench</spirit:userFileType>
756759
</spirit:file>
757760
<spirit:file>
758761
<spirit:name>src/hm2_axilite_int_tb.vhd</spirit:name>
759762
<spirit:fileType>vhdlSource</spirit:fileType>
760763
<spirit:userFileType>IMPORTED_FILE</spirit:userFileType>
764+
<spirit:userFileType>USED_IN_simulation</spirit:userFileType>
765+
<spirit:userFileType>USED_IN_testbench</spirit:userFileType>
761766
</spirit:file>
762767
</spirit:fileSet>
763768
<spirit:fileSet>
@@ -791,29 +796,28 @@
791796
<xilinx:coreExtensions>
792797
<xilinx:supportedFamilies>
793798
<xilinx:family xilinx:lifeCycle="Production">zynq</xilinx:family>
799+
<xilinx:family xilinx:lifeCycle="Beta">zynquplus</xilinx:family>
794800
</xilinx:supportedFamilies>
795801
<xilinx:taxonomies>
796802
<xilinx:taxonomy>/UserIP</xilinx:taxonomy>
797803
</xilinx:taxonomies>
798804
<xilinx:displayName>hm2_axilite_int_v1_0</xilinx:displayName>
799805
<xilinx:vendorDisplayName>MachineKit</xilinx:vendorDisplayName>
800806
<xilinx:vendorURL>http://www.machinekit.io</xilinx:vendorURL>
801-
<xilinx:coreRevision>6</xilinx:coreRevision>
807+
<xilinx:coreRevision>9</xilinx:coreRevision>
802808
<xilinx:upgrades>
803809
<xilinx:canUpgradeFrom>user.org:user:hm2_axilite_int:1.0</xilinx:canUpgradeFrom>
804810
</xilinx:upgrades>
805-
<xilinx:coreCreationDateTime>2016-04-29T02:53:09Z</xilinx:coreCreationDateTime>
806-
<xilinx:tags>
807-
</xilinx:tags>
811+
<xilinx:coreCreationDateTime>2019-09-09T13:52:32Z</xilinx:coreCreationDateTime>
808812
</xilinx:coreExtensions>
809813
<xilinx:packagingInfo>
810-
<xilinx:xilinxVersion>2015.4</xilinx:xilinxVersion>
811-
<xilinx:checksum xilinx:scope="busInterfaces" xilinx:value="6981b8db"/>
812-
<xilinx:checksum xilinx:scope="memoryMaps" xilinx:value="506ef2f7"/>
813-
<xilinx:checksum xilinx:scope="fileGroups" xilinx:value="ca07ea16"/>
814-
<xilinx:checksum xilinx:scope="ports" xilinx:value="a3f4f143"/>
815-
<xilinx:checksum xilinx:scope="hdlParameters" xilinx:value="add4e91a"/>
816-
<xilinx:checksum xilinx:scope="parameters" xilinx:value="41d818d8"/>
814+
<xilinx:xilinxVersion>2019.1</xilinx:xilinxVersion>
815+
<xilinx:checksum xilinx:scope="busInterfaces" xilinx:value="c873e378"/>
816+
<xilinx:checksum xilinx:scope="memoryMaps" xilinx:value="8518f7a4"/>
817+
<xilinx:checksum xilinx:scope="fileGroups" xilinx:value="83641e08"/>
818+
<xilinx:checksum xilinx:scope="ports" xilinx:value="f07e1534"/>
819+
<xilinx:checksum xilinx:scope="hdlParameters" xilinx:value="401f61ab"/>
820+
<xilinx:checksum xilinx:scope="parameters" xilinx:value="fbe43eed"/>
817821
</xilinx:packagingInfo>
818822
</spirit:vendorExtensions>
819823
</spirit:component>

HW/zynq-ip/hm2_axilite/src/hm2_axilite_gen32_simreg.vhd

100755100644
File mode changed.

0 commit comments

Comments
 (0)